** The Volvo repair market for Abercrombie, ND residents is entirely centered in the Fargo-Moorhead area, approximately a 25-30 minute drive away. The market is characterized by a healthy mix of a single, factory-authorized dealership and several robust independent shops. This provides Volvo owners with clear choices based on their needs: the dealership for warranty work, the latest model expertise, and certified recalibrations, or the independents for cost-effective, expert repairs on a wider range of model years. Competition is strong among the top providers, which helps maintain a high standard of quality and customer service. Pricing follows the expected structure, with dealership labor rates and parts costs being the highest, while independent shops offer significant savings, typically 20-30% lower, without a substantial sacrifice in quality for most repair types. For residents of Abercrombie, while there are no local options, the proximity to Fargo ensures access to excellent Volvo service.

The cold winters and road salt in the Abercrombie area can accelerate corrosion of brake lines, suspension components, and exhaust systems. Also, ensure your Volvo's all-wheel-drive (AWD) system is serviced to handle slippery conditions, and pay close attention to battery health during extreme cold snaps.

Seek professional service for any check engine lights, electrical issues, or complex systems like the turbocharger or AWD. For local DIY enthusiasts, basic maintenance like cabin air filter changes is feasible, but the advanced electronics in modern Volvos often require specialized tools and software for proper diagnosis.
Labor rates in the Fargo area are competitive, but parts costs can be higher due to shipping to Abercrombie and lower local inventory for European models. Building a relationship with a local shop that can efficiently source parts is key to managing costs and avoiding long wait times for repairs.
